Respen is disgusted by the trophy room. He never hunted for trophies. He certainly had hunted for sport in the past, but he never had much use for trophies.

It always seemed macabre and vain to him. He had encountered giants before, but not like these cretins. The stone giants to the west of the Enllaves sent representatives to his uncle’s funeral. They were a dignified people. Small in number, but large in heart and hope. This rabble was a foul and revolting lot.

Surveying the battle at either end of the trophy room, the irony of the giants being the hunted produces a wry smile. The lightning bolt from the south startles him, the crackle of thunder and the smell of ozone overwhelm his senses for an instant. He turns his attention toward the south. Seeing the struggling Nosnra reeling from successive blows from Kleborn and Vale, Respen resolves to end this particular threat. Without saying a word, he sprints toward Vale, notching his bow, and slides with arrow ready next to Vale, 25-30 feet from Nosnra and one of the stone elders.

“Adieu géant,” he says as he releases the arrows; it is the last thing Nosnra sees, and he is dead before his head hits the ground. The arrow sticks shaft deep into his right eye, breaking his cheekbone, gouging his eye, lacerating his ear canal, and burying itself deep into his brain. The puncture leaves little blood as it pools internally. To Vale and Kleborn, as well as the giants in the room, the visual and auditory effect is instantaneous. There is no confusion; the hill giant king is very dead.

Before Nosnra’s head hits the ground, Respen releases his second attack against the stone giant closest to him (S2). The arrow also strikes home with a “snikt” sound, piercing the stone giant long-ways in his forearm like an elongated splinter.
